Tea Lake Dam (Access Point #3) provides convenient day-use picnic and access infrastructure for paddlers exploring tea lakes region through whitewater sections and smaller lake systems. This access point serves as a jumping-off spot for trips incorporating Whiskey Rapids, Upper Twin Falls, and downstream river paddling toward Oxtongue Lake, though detailed trip route information is limited in available sources. Best approached as a day paddling destination or starting point for experienced intermediate paddlers comfortable with occasional whitewater. Limited established trip routes reduce overall rating; consult official park maps and outfitters for current conditions and route recommendations.
Access 3 (Tea Lake Dam) is estimated at Intermediate. Whitewater ratings are not exact: grades change with water level and season. Verify current conditions locally before you paddle.
The best time is May-September.
Access 3 (Tea Lake Dam) is located in the Algonquin Provincial Park region of Canada.
